"Forget it. Regardless of their origins, now that Mahayana-stage beings have appeared, it seems that matter truly cannot be kept hidden any longer. I might as well spread the news far and wide and use their strength to take a gamble. That would be better than missing the opening window and gaining nothing at all." The masked figure's gaze flickered several times before it finally steeled its resolve. With a flick of its sleeve, its body twisted and vanished directly into the void.

At this time, Han Li was already walking along a street, entering and exiting several large-looking shops to replenish some supplementary materials. He purchased nothing else, however, and headed directly to a more secluded inn-like establishment, where he rented a private courtyard and settled in to meditate without venturing out again.

Three days later, Han Li returned to the plaza with a peculiar expression on his face. He found Patriarch Shi and Zhu Guo'er, who had been waiting there all along, and brought them back to their lodgings.

He then informed the pair that he had suddenly gained some insights into a particular secret technique, so the matter of the ancient altar would need to be set aside for now. He had to go into seclusion for a time, and told them both to cultivate properly here as well and not to leave rashly.

Patriarch Shi and Zhu Guo'er naturally nodded in agreement.

And so, for the next month or so, none of them left their lodgings a single step, all cultivating behind closed doors.

More than a month later, one day, Han Li, who had been meditating inside his room, suddenly opened both eyes as though he had sensed something. His expression darkened, and golden light blazed across his body in an instant as he transformed into a golden streak that shot out of the room.

Almost at the same moment, a heaven-shaking, earth-shattering boom erupted.

A colossal sphere of light, like a blazing sun, suddenly exploded above the inn. Ring after ring of shockwaves rippled outward, and in their wake, buildings crumbled and collapsed. Some Blood Sky people caught in the blast were likewise reduced to mists of blood that burst apart.

Only a handful with higher cultivation or who had managed to release treasures to protect themselves in time managed to rush outside the shockwave's range, gazing upward in a mixture of fury and alarm.

Patriarch Shi and Zhu Guo'er were naturally among them.

Although the sky-restriction prevented anyone from taking to the air to approach for a closer look, the distance was more than sufficient to make out the scene above with perfect clarity.

Where the blazing sun had exploded moments ago, two figures now hovered high in the sky, facing each other from afar.

One was a young man wearing a Daoist robe. The other was a white-haired old woman whose face was covered in wrinkles. Both radiated waves of astonishing power.

It was clear that the commotion just now had been caused by these two.

"Mahayana Patriarchs — those are Mahayana Patriarchs! Otherwise, Blood Crane City's sky-restriction is far too powerful — even Integration-stage beings can't ascend very high!" someone blurted out in shock.

The survivors below, who had been seething with rage moments before, all drew sharp breaths at these words. After exchanging a few glances, they fled in every direction without looking back.

You had to be joking — with two Mahayana Patriarchs fighting openly, would staying here not simply be seeking death?

As for demanding an explanation, that was something they wouldn't even dare think about.

Still, the fact that two Mahayana Patriarchs had appeared in Blood Crane City all at once was enough to send the entire city into an uproar.

Patriarch Shi and Zhu Guo'er had not spotted Han Li's figure. Though somewhat surprised, they felt no real concern and simply remained where they were with composure.

At that moment, a cold male voice suddenly drifted down from high above:

"You two fellow daoists are quite formidable. Fighting so recklessly like this — do you truly place no value on the Blood Bone Gate's existence?"

A faint ripple of fluctuation arose.

In the void between the young Daoist and the old woman, white light flashed, and a man wearing a white mask appeared soundlessly.

The mask was extraordinarily pale, inscribed with several faint silver spirit patterns. It concealed everything except a pair of dark eyes, revealing not a single other feature.

"Xiao Ming, you've finally deigned to show yourself. I wonder who was hiding from us all this time. Hmph — if you hadn't appeared, I would have torn this entire city apart," the old woman snorted, rolling her eyes upward.
